Position Overview

We are seeking a Chemist to join our Skincare Development team in our Clark, NJ facility for Research & Innovation. You will create, coordinate, and implement innovative skincare product development programs to support our innovation strategies. Your responsibilities include developing robust, technically sound formulation solutions that meet safety, regulatory, and quality requirements; initiating lab‑scale experimentation; evaluating compatibility and stability; and ensuring a smooth transition of innovative products through development to manufacturing.

You will work in a matrix‑reporting organization, collaborating with both local R&I and international teams.

Responsibilities
  • Develop new and robust skincare formulations correlating the relationship between ingredients and performance.
  • Collaborate with cross‑functional teams to deliver on aggressive timelines with maximized operational efficiency.
  • Consider processing, operating, and design factors that affect skincare formulations.
  • Apply creativity and resourcefulness to solve issues that may arise during product development or in anticipation of pilot plant or manufacturing challenges.
  • Support brand post‑launch activities, including participation in lab events with external guests to showcase formulation expertise and brand superiority.
Qualifications
  • Education: Bachelor’s degree in Chemistry, Chemical Engineering, Data Science, or a related scientific/engineering discipline is required. A Master’s degree is a plus.
  • Experience: 1‑3 years of hands‑on experience in formulation research, ideally in a personal care or cosmetic field.
    • Experience in skincare is a plus.
    • Proven experience in research and development, demonstrating a project‑oriented mindset focused on delivering robust, innovative, and highly functional products.
